Korean Drama " Island " is the first part of the sci fi fantasy drama that is a webtoon adaption.
The drama has some intriguing characters and a gothic mood to it, with a few notions of horror and a lot of mystical plotlines.
It would have aided the drama a lot with the two main characters had more scenes together and better chemistry to justify their 'bond' and help the viewer engage and care about them.
The story, also, needed more time to have a proper development.
Nevertheless, it was enjoyable and the performances were pretty nice.
So, overall, seven stars out of ten for the first part of the series.
Korean Drama " Island Season Two " is the second part of the sci fi series with a horror undertone.
The story goes deeper into the past of the heroes and the myth that surrounds the island. The big battle finally arrives as well, with the drama focusing on the characters preparing for it.
On the plus side, the mood was there and the fantasy element was well handled.
On the other hand, the characters turned out to be cliche stereotypes, especially when it came to the reincarnation of the main lead, which was eye-rolling at some point.
The performances were enjoyable though.
So, overall, six out of ten.

The show uses a lot of borrowed fantasy elements (both literally and figuratively) from other K dramas and western shows, which will make it feel less original and familiar. The show is an adaptation of YLAB's webtoon, "The Island", so expect a comic book feel to the story and action sequences. Special effects and scenes will also seem familiar with another show produced by Studio Dragon called Alchemy of Souls.
Van, the lead male character, is an ancient demon slayer. Van's origin story reminds me of The Witcher in some ways. But he is a serial killer in the webtoon, so I'm not sure if they will work that into or out of the TV screenplay. (Trivia: Korean spoken language has no "V" sound, so why "Van", I don't know.)
As a horror genre show, it's decent enough to watch. Live-action adaptation of comic book/anime/cartoon shows are challenging, but this show should to be entertaining enough for those not familiar with the webtoon.

Quite impressive visually. Part One consists of the first 6 episodes of this series. The sets are atmospheric although it doesn't look like the Jeju we know, all dark and gothic and mystical with demons and stuff. Great production values for a tv series. Movie quality effects combine with exciting action sequences. The exorcisms are quite scary even for jaded viewers. There are some back stories to give some connection to the characters. Things get quite dark towards the later episodes. The actors are well cast. Kim Nam Gil has quite a moody vibe as the half human half demon. Cha Eun Woo as the angelic looking priest. Lee Da Hee is fine as the heroine but can't help imagining how great the unique looking Seo Ye Ji would have been in this role if she hadn't been unfairly cancelled. Sung Joon plays a demon. Everyone is quite convincing.

- CuriosidadesBased on webcomic "Island" written by Yoon In-Wan & illustrated by Yang Kyung-Il (published from May 11, 2016 to February 15, 2018 via Naver).
